    Abstract: An arrangement in an intelligent network for queuing incoming calls to a destination number during peak calling times and initiating call-backs based on the order that the incoming calls were originally placed in the queue. Translation tables in a subscriber's telephone switching office have terminate attempt triggers and disconnect triggers set to the subscriber's number. A disconnect detection triggers a query from the telephone switching office to an integrated services control point (ISCP), at which point the ISCP accesses the first caller in the queue and sends a message to the originating office serving the first caller to ring the first caller and the subscriber's number. A call to the subscriber's number triggers a query from the telephone switching office serving the subscriber to the ISCP. If the call is from the first caller in the queue, the ISCP instructs the telephone switching office to connect the call to the subscriber.

    Abstract: A method and system for providing operator services to an interexchange carrier for completing a long distance telephone call for which an operator service is indicated. The interexchange carrier call requiring operator services is connected from the interexchange carrier (IXW) network to a point-of-presence (POP) of the interexchange carrier within a local access transport area (LATA). From the POP the call is connected to an operator service system (OSS) external to the IXC network and within the LATA. The OSS completes the call in accordance with a request for service from the caller. An SS7 signaling system is used to route calls from a terminating switch in the interexchange carrier network to an end office, so that the call legs of the operator service system can be switched out of the call path.

    Abstract: A system for controlling the acquisition of encrypted program signals such as television or other signals utilizing existing equipment in use in telecommunications networks. The transmitted program signals are encrypted subject to decryption for presentation by a receiver such as a television receiver. A subscriber unit associated with the receiver receives the signals and is connected to the telecommunications network. The subscriber unit also receives program order commands from a subscriber and responsive to such a command transmits to the telecommunications network an order which enables the telecommunications network to identify the directory number to which the subscriber unit is connected and the number of the subscriber unit. Upon validation the telecommunications network returns to the subscriber unit a first decryption key which is stored in the subscriber unit.

    Abstract: A peripheral platform, such as an Intelligent Peripheral (IP), is a network subsystem for use in the Advanced Intelligent Network (AIN). The IP or similar platform will assume some functions presently performed by the Integrated Service Control Point (ISCP) and central office switches. Among its functional capabilities will be voice announcement and digit collection. The more advanced version, the IP, also offers speech recognition capabilities and an array of other enhanced call processing features, such as voice or facsimile messaging. The peripheral platform or IP will be a separate network component that will communicate with the ISCP, which controls the AIN, through a data communication network that in the preferred embodiments is distinct from the telephone company switching offices, trunk networks and any associated interoffice signalling network.

    Abstract: A method for providing switch translations upon a failure in the conventional recent change message handling system. The failure results in triggering a common channel signaling inquiry, to a signaling control point which responds with instructions for setting up a common channel signaling link between the Recent Change Memory Administration Center (RCMAC) to an alternate Remote Memory Administration System (RMAS). The RCMAC then delivers the recent change message to the alternate RMAS and the RMAS delivers the recent change signal to the addressed switch. In an alternate embodiment the Signal Control Point is provided with RMAS capability. This RMAS capability is then used in place of the alternate RMAS and the SCP sets up a path from the SCP associated RMAS to the RCMAC and to the addressed switch. The communication from the RCMAC which initiated the inquiry to the SCP and RMAS associated therewith is in common channel signaling protocol.

    Abstract: A short dedicated code, such as an N11 telephone number, is used to access an information source selected from a large number of voice, data, facsimile and/or video services offered by information service providers. The system can use a single N11 number for all calls, or a first code number for preprogrammed call processing and a second number for casual access. The system can route an information service call based at least in part on preprogrammed selection data for the caller stored in a central data base, or can prompt a casual caller for various inputs to determine which service the caller currently wants to access. The disclosed system of call routing eliminates the need for information service users to know a large number of different telephone numbers to access a variety of information services. In the preferred embodiments, the user only needs to know one or two three-digit N11 type access numbers, such as 211 or 511.

    Abstract: A call forwarding parameter, which a communication network uses to control forwarding of a subscriber's incoming calls to a centralized messaging system, is varied as a function of the status of a subscriber's services within the centralized messaging system. This forwarding control may apply to a variety of different types of communication network and/or to a variety of centralized messaging systems. For example, if the messaging system provides voice mail type services, and the communication network is a public switched telephone network, the voice mail system might instruct the network to change the threshold ringing interval or the threshold number of rings before forwarding unanswered calls directed to a subscriber to the voice mail system, as a function of the status of that subscriber's mailbox.
